So we have f ( x, y) = f ( x ′, y ′) and we … gullah food tourshttp://web.math.ku.dk/~rordam/students/rohde-thesis.pdf bowl blanks cheapWebbInjectivity and surjectivity describe properties of a function. An injection, or one-to-one function, is a function for which no two distinct inputs produce the same output. A surjection, or onto function, is a function for which every element in the codomain has at least one corresponding input in the domain which produces that output. bowl big enough for a godWebbSoluciona tus problemas matemáticos con nuestro solucionador matemático gratuito, que incluye soluciones paso a paso.
